Decibel Cannabis Co Surges 7.2% on Elevated Trading Volume
DBCCF shares jumped to $0.09 amid increased investor interest, with daily volume reaching 39,901 shares as the Canadian LP continues recovery efforts.
Decibel Cannabis Co (OTC: DBCCF) experienced a notable surge of 7.2% during today's trading session, with shares climbing to $0.09 on elevated volume of 39,901 shares. The move represents continued momentum for the Canadian licensed producer as it works to stabilize operations and rebuild investor confidence following a challenging period in the cannabis sector.
Current Market Position
The $0.09 trading price places Decibel Cannabis well within its 52-week trading range of $0.04 to $0.11, suggesting the stock is finding support above its yearly lows while still trading below previous highs. With a current market capitalization of $36.1 million, the company remains a smaller player in the Canadian cannabis landscape, though today's volume spike indicates renewed investor attention.
The 7.2% gain comes against a backdrop of mixed performance across cannabis equities, with many licensed producers continuing to face operational and financial headwinds. Decibel's ability to generate positive momentum suggests potential catalysts may be driving investor interest, though the company has not released specific news to explain today's price action.

Industry Context and Challenges
Decibel Cannabis operates within Canada's regulated cannabis market, which has faced significant challenges including oversupply, pricing pressure, and regulatory complexities. Many licensed producers have struggled with profitability, leading to consolidation and restructuring across the sector.
The Canadian cannabis industry has seen mixed results in 2024, with some operators achieving profitability while others continue to burn cash. Decibel's position as a smaller LP means it faces additional challenges in competing with larger, better-capitalized rivals for market share and distribution opportunities.
Recent industry data suggests that Canadian cannabis sales have stabilized after years of volatility, with legal market share continuing to grow at the expense of illicit operators. This broader trend could benefit companies like Decibel if they can execute operationally and maintain competitive positioning.
